Refining Legal Operations: A Staff Automation Approach to Case Tracking
Wiki Article
In the dynamic landscape of legal practice, efficiency and accuracy are paramount. To excel, law firms must embrace innovative approaches that streamline operations and enhance case management. One such approach involves leveraging staff automation for case tracking. By implementing automated systems, legal professionals can minimize the burden of manual data entry, enabling them to focus on more complex aspects of their work.
- Automated case tracking systems provide a comprehensive platform for managing all facets of a case, from initial intake to final resolution.
- These systems can execute routine tasks such as document filing, deadline reminders, and client communication, freeing up staff time for more demanding responsibilities.
- Boosted visibility into case progress allows attorneys to track the status of their cases in real-time, enabling informed decision-making.
Furthermore, staff automation can improve data integrity and accuracy, eliminating human error. This contributes to the overall efficiency and effectiveness of legal operations, allowing firms to offer exceptional client service while refining their workflows.
Automating Financial Services for Enhanced Efficiency and Accuracy
Automating financial services is rapidly transforming the industry, leading to significant enhancements in both efficiency and accuracy. Implementing adv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ML), financial institutions can automate a wide range of tasks, like transaction processing, fraud detection, and customer service. This automation not only reduces manual effort but also prevents human error, leading to more reliable and consistent outcomes.
Furthermore, automated systems can process information at a much faster pace than humans, enabling financial institutions to offer quicker service and make real-time decisions. The implementation of automation also enhances customer satisfaction by providing a more seamless experience.
In conclusion, automating financial services presents numerous benefits for both institutions and customers, paving the way for a more efficient and protected financial landscape.
